The HEAP Eligibility and Certification web-based course provides training in determining Regular and Emergency Home Energy Assistance Program (HEAP) benefit decisions.
The course uses interactive examples to review how to process and verify an application for HEAP, how to determine the eligibility of an applicant, and how to calculate the value of any benefit that may be due to a household in need. The course covers policies, procedures, and best practices that help assure an efficient and accurate implementation of the HEAP program. The course has been updated for the 2012-2013 heating season.
Objectives
Upon successful completion of this course, the student should be able to:
- Explain the Home Energy Assistance Program (HEAP) and associated terminology
- Differentiate between HEAP household types and the application process for each
- Explain categorical eligibility as it applies to HEAP
- Determine HEAP household composition in terms of applying versus non-applying household members
- Correctly document HEAP eligibility factors using the Budget Worksheet
- Accurately calculate gross monthly income for HEAP applicants
- Accurately determine eligibility for Regular HEAP benefits
- Accurately determine eligibility for Emergency HEAP benefits
